    Customer wants a SIG P226 but with the Short Reset Trigger already installed. The roster has the "P226 (Blued) / Stainless Steel, Alloy" which has been on there for years. The case is marked 226-40-B. Up until recently, the ones I've seen didn't come with a SRT installed. SIG now offers that. Do you think the SRT version still falls under the "P226 (Blued) / Stainless Steel, Alloy" definition?

    Most likely it would be considered a different model, especially since it was not tested in that configuration.

    If you look on the list, the Sig P229 SAS is listed and if you look at the Sig P229 SAS2, you will see that it is marked as being just a SAS, but it is not really on the list as it is a different model. It gets confusing since the list does not show the actual model number.
